Hello Everyone
Here is my Story,
About 2 weeks ago i got a low oil pressure light and weird noise from my engine. I had the car towed to a dealership in NJ and next day they called me telling me i have an Oil Sludge and that i need to privide them with the maintanence records and they will be able to help me out. I also could not get a loaner car until i provide the oil change receipts. Today after i got all the receipts and after spending $400 on rental cars i went to the dealership and gave them all my oil change reciepts which they accepted and told me they will submit them to Audi.
An hour later i got a phone call from the dealership telling me that my vin number falls out of the Extended Oil Sludge Warranty since i have a later 2004 model and that they can not do anything for me. I called Audi of America and they told me the same thing. The dealer gave me a $10,000 estimate for a rebuilt engine and turbo and said they will offer me $300 goodwill. I am shocked, need help, what should i do?
